Understanding Parrots: Species and Costs
Before diving into the acquiring process, it's critical to understand the numerous parrot types readily available and their associated expenses. Below is a table summing up typical parrot types, their typical rates, and typical qualities.
Parrot SpeciesAverage Price (EUR)Lifespan (Years)Size (cm)TemperamentBudgerigar20 - 1005 - 1018 - 20Friendly, SocialCockatiel50 - 15010 - 1530Lively, AffectionateLovebird30 - 10010 - 1513 - 17Curious, AffectionateAmazon Parrot300 - 1,50025 - 5030 - 40Smart, VocalAfrican Grey800 - 2,00040 - 6030 - 35Intelligent, SocialMacaw1,000 - 3,00050 - 8075 - 100Social, VocalSecret Considerations
Area Requirements: Larger parrots, like macaws, need more space to prosper. Consider the size of your living environment before choosing.
Time Commitment: Parrots are social animals and require everyday interaction and stimulation. Potential owners require to be prepared for a long-term commitment, specifically considering that numerous species can live a number of decades.
Diet plan and Care: Each species has particular dietary requirements, which can include seeds, fruits, veggies, African Grey Parrot Breeding and specialized pellets. Correct care is important for their well-being.
Legal Requirements for Owning a Parrot in Germany
In Germany, there are particular legal requirements for owning a parrot, particularly concerning unique animals. Potential parrot owners should be conscious of the following regulations:
Registration: Some species require registration with the local authorities. Family pet shops are popular for first-time purchasers due to their availability. Nevertheless, it is crucial to guarantee that the store sticks to ethical practices and can provide a health warranty. Always inquire about the bird's age, health background, and socialization.
Breeders
Finding a trusted breeder can result in healthier and more sociable birds. Breeders typically have comprehensive knowledge about the specific types. They can also supply information on genetics, diet plan, and care.
Animal Shelters and Rescues
Embracing a parrot from a shelter is a worthy option. It not just offers a bird a 2nd chance however likewise frequently comes at a lower cost. Numerous shelters perform health check-ups and behavioral assessments before putting birds in homes.
Online Classifieds
Websites like eBay Kleinanzeigen can use lots. However, possible purchasers should be careful and request to see the bird and its present living conditions before making a purchase.

What is the typical life-span of a parrot?
The lifespan differs by types. Budgerigars typically live 5-10 years, while bigger species like macaws can measure up to 80 years.
2. Are parrots noisy?
Yes, parrots can be quite singing, especially larger species. If noise is a concern, consider smaller, quieter species like cockatiels or budgerigars.
3. How do I choose the ideal species for my home?
Consider your home, the time you have for interaction, and your experience level. Research various species and speak with breeders or pet store personnel for assistance.
4. Are there any special grooming needs for parrots?
Regular nail trimming, beak care, and occasional baths are required. Some species may need more frequent attention than others.
5. Can I train my parrot?
Yes, parrots are highly smart and can be trained through positive support. Training helps improve their behavior and enhance your bond.
